Output 88916efaa3a1004578da7bfb69a5a15fadbc26997c23d0af2037ed134c512491:1

value
2515160
script pubkey
OP_0 OP_PUSHBYTES_20 93695b44ab2a190d3b2f2c4afd6764635c612c5c
address
ltc1qjd54k39t9gvs6we093906emyvdwxztzugna5mt
transaction
88916efaa3a1004578da7bfb69a5a15fadbc26997c23d0af2037ed134c512491
spent
true